Abstract (EN)
The deep mixing column is one of the soil improvement methods that is extensively used to improve the weak or problematic soils in order to increase the bearing capacity and reduce the settlement applied by creating mixed columns which include in-situ mixing of soil and Portland cement or lime with special machines. The goal of this study was to estimate the possibility of replacing waste glass soda powder with Portland cement in the binder for stabilization of sandy soil using the deep mixing method in order to reduce the consumption of cement. The grounded waste glass soda to a fine powder shows some pozzolanic properties due to the silica content. Three laboratory tests were carried out (Vicat test, unconfined compressive test and Ultrasonic pulse velocity) in order to investigate the effect of the glass powder that replaced with cement in the binder at different proportions (0%, 3%, 6%, 9% by dry weight) has been experimentally investigated for the deep mixing on the performances of loose sand with various clay contents (4%, 8%, 20% by dry weight). It is found from the testing results that i) the glass powder is not able to accelerate the setting time of grout, ii) the bulk density does not significantly change with the glass powder, clay content and curing time, iii) The best value of UCS can be obtained at the 28-days curing time due to the addition 3% of glass powder at the 20% clay content of sand, iv) the elastic modulus correlates well with the UCS values (R ≥ 83) at the majority of soilcrete samples and v) the best UPV can be obtained at the 28-days curing time due to the addition 3%of glass powder at the 4% clay content of sand.
